Output 143baf68e3e86ec890eae1ba49db0a13639a7e7f8eb75f1d95fab8753a6571f1:0

value
3163935
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 93645e2dd1fe60d80ffdac19e6cab54e59f776c7 OP_EQUALVERIFY OP_CHECKSIG
address
1ESLZtAN6USEHaeVq2C1xDRpqUSGfBe9Fm
transaction
143baf68e3e86ec890eae1ba49db0a13639a7e7f8eb75f1d95fab8753a6571f1
spent
true